Question to the Department of Health and Social Care:

To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, what steps he is taking to reduce excess mortality among people with diabetes.

This question was answered on 5th December 2022

A £5 million national recovery fund for routine diabetes care was established in 2021/22, which has approved 28 projects to be delivered in 2022/23. Integrated care boards have been asked to focus funding on recovery, the eight diabetes annual checks, prioritising those patients most at risk of diabetes-related deterioration and reducing inequalities.
